Phone number ☎️ 02476980460 👆 is reported as a persistent scam involving calls from individuals claiming to represent banks or insurance companies, often using UK numbers but suspected to originate from abroad. Targets include vulnerable people, including those with dementia, with callers pressuring recipients to update or add insurance policies, often domestic appliance or life insurance. They frequently refuse to provide verifiable details, ignore refusals, and sometimes become aggressive or coercive. Victims have noticed attempts to obtain bank details to amend payments. Many do not leave messages and calls often come around mealtimes. Several report blocking numbers with limited success despite TPS registration. The calls are typically recognised as fraudulent from the outset due to incorrect or inconsistent information.

About 02 Numbers
These numbers correspond to specific locations in the UK and are frequently used by homes and businesses. Also known as as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are dependent on the time of day. Numerous service providers offer call packages that provide free calls during selected times. Call costs from mobile phones are reliant on the chosen calling plan, with a lot of plans including these numbers in their free call packages.
